About Ruo‐Yao Fan

Ruo‐Yao Fan is a scholar working on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ment, Electrochemistry,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Catalysis and Process Chemistry and Technology, having authored 42 papers that have together received 1.5k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Electrocatalysts for Energy Conversion (40 papers), Advanced battery technologies research (33 papers), Fuel Cells and Related Materials (15 papers), Electrochemical Analysis and Applications (10 papers), Advanced Photocatalysis Techniques (6 papers), Catalytic Processes in Materials Science (5 papers), Advanced Memory and Neural Computing (2 papers) and Ammonia Synthesis and Nitrogen Reduction (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ment (1.3k citations), Electrochemistry (311 citations), Electrical and Electronic Engineering (1.0k citations), Catalysis (110 citations) and Energy Engineering and Power Technology (36 citations). Ruo‐Yao Fan has collaborated with scholars based in China, United States and Germany. Frequent co-authors include Bin Dong, Yong‐Ming Chai, Yanan Zhou, Haijun Liu, Wen‐Li Yu, Jingyi Xie, Fuli Wang, Meng-Xuan Li, Ning Yu and Yu Ma. Their work appears in journals such as International Journal of Hydrogen Energy, Applied Catalysis B: Environmental, Inorganic Chemistry Frontiers, Chemical Engineering Journal and Nanoscale.
